Iran Oil Show 2026: The Epicenter of Middle Eastern Energy Innovation
Scheduled for May 8-11, 2026, in Tehran, Iran, the Iran Oil Show (IOS) stands as the premier international exhibition and conference dedicated to the country's vast energy sector and its global partners. Building on its decades-long legacy, the 2026 edition is poised to be a critical platform for navigating the evolving dynamics of the global oil and gas industry, particularly within the strategically vital Middle Eastern region. As Iran continues to hold the world's fourth-largest proven oil reserves and the second-largest natural gas reserves, the IOS remains an indispensable event for industry professionals seeking insights, partnerships, and technological solutions.
A Showcase of Comprehensive Energy Solutions:
The exhibition floor at Iran Oil Show 2026 will transform into a bustling marketplace of innovation and capability. Expect to see a vast array of exhibitors showcasing cutting-edge technologies and services across the entire energy value chain:
Upstream: Advanced exploration and seismic technologies, drilling equipment (onshore/offshore), well completion & stimulation, reservoir engineering, and enhanced oil recovery (EOR) techniques.
Downstream: Refining technologies, petrochemical plants & equipment, gas processing, LNG solutions, pipeline infrastructure, and storage facilities.
Services: Eng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) firms, logistics, maintenance, inspection, and certification services.
Emerging Tech: Digitalization solutions (IoT, AI, big data), automation, cybersecurity for critical infrastructure, carbon capture utilization and storage (CCUS), and hydrogen technologies.
Renewables & Sustainability: While rooted in hydrocarbons, the show increasingly features solutions for energy transition, including solar, wind, and bioenergy integration projects relevant to Iran's energy mix.
